Output 59083052cd5f62b2995621e7973e10641c1419e7504cacd0595cda4f319a5105:1

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836bd70df5a34f8cccddd51cad5737a2f3dea037 OP_EQUAL
address
3DfudXp3CUGYvH3qTbAezFwP82NPgTku2E
transaction
59083052cd5f62b2995621e7973e10641c1419e7504cacd0595cda4f319a5105
spent
true